Back to normal this week though and it's Amanda's turn to pick the challenge and she would like to see your folded cards and/or autumn colours - you can do one, or the other, or both!

For some reason giving me two things to do stumped me this week though, but I got there in the end, making a tag card thingy.  Why on earth I didn't take the more obvious route and make an easel card I have no idea!!  I did glue my folds shut, so hope that is ok... hmmmm, with hindsight I wish I'd left them open, was having a bit of a dim moment I guess!!


I was also struggling big time for papers.  I'm not going to admit this to my HB because he wouldn't believe that was possible considering the space my papers take up, but I settled on a DCWV pad - I think it is one of the middle east collections, as I thought the colours of these pages were fairly autumnal :-D


I love the Shoes 'n' Bags stamps - this one is called the ruffle and I coloured it in autumnal colours and added a small hint of sparkle to the shoes and some glossy accents to the metal bits.

The sentiment stamp is from the Sentimental Numbers set - this is one set that is always on my desk and I reach for over and over as the sizing is PERFECT!!
